Gafftopsail Catfish (Bagre marinus) is a marine catfish inhabiting the waters of the western central Atlantic Ocean, as well as the Gulf of Mexico and the Caribbean Sea. It eats mostly crustaceans, including crabs, shrimp, and prawns (95% of the diet), but it will also eat worms, other invertebrates, and bony fishes (about 5% of the diet). Aptly named for the pronounced dorsal fin that rises from their back like a sail, gafftopsail catfish are common in Florida's saltwater back bays and estuaries, particularly on the gulf side of the state. Though not as popular or respected as their freshwater counterparts, there are two species of catfish commonly caught in coastal waters of Texas: the gafftop, Bagre marinus, and sea catfish, more commonly known as hardhead, Arius felis. Spawning seems to take place in May, with the male holding up to 55 eggs in his mouth until they hatch, and then holding the young . Typically growing to about 43 cm (16 in) in length, these fish usually weigh around 0.5 to 2 kg (1.1 to 4.4 lb), but with some luck it is possible to land a trophy of up to 4.5 kg (9.9 lb). Its appearance is typical for a catfish except for the deeply forked tail and the venomous, serrated spines. Gafftop Catfish, also known as Sail Catfish, Sailtop Catfish and Sailcats, are easily identified by a tall spike on their dorsal fin that sticks up like the sail of a ship. Unlike many other catfish, which are primarily bottom feeders, the gafftopsail catfish feeds throughout the water column. The Gafftopsail Catfish, Bagre marinus, is a member of the Sea Catfish or Ariidae Family, that is also known as the Gafftopsail Sea Catfish and and in Mexico as bagre bandera.
